Women’s train at the Showgrounds Monday 6:30-8 pm.

The main training night during the season will be Wednesday nights. Leonard & Madden train and play as one squad. The season starts on April 3rd 2022. The training times are subject to change once the Tuesday/Thursday Twilight Six A Side and Futsal Indoor competitions finish.

Newcomers are encouraged to show up to training, meet Head Coach Stephen Burns and the rest of the girl’s team! Southies pride themselves on an inclusive enjoyable atmosphere that fosters development. Souths fielded a First Grade women’s last year after a brief time away and are enjoying a promising rebuild in the top grade. Come join the party in 2022!

Souths’ Leonard was fifth on the precipice of the Top Four when last season was abandoned due to Coronavirus. The Madden side sat inside the four and was enjoying a sharp uptake in form.
The Club is excited to build on 2021 with a progressive style of play that will excite in 2022.

Men’s train at the Showgrounds on Sundays & Wednesdays 7-8:30 pm.

The 1st & 2nd Grade Men currently train on Sunday & Wednesday 7-8:30 pm. First Grade coach Andy Heller encourages new players to join the sessions and opens that invite to any third or fourth graders looking to blow out the cobwebs in the lead up to Round 1 on the first weekend in April. New players arriving are welcome to join to find their spot in the Warriors five men’s teams. These times are also subject to change when Futsal & Twilight end – not to mention cricket (a vice the Englishmen Andy understandably doesn’t understand).

First & Second grade play and train as a squad throughout the year and preseason training is crucial for success in 2022. Training has been at a high intensity with old faces shedding the kilos & new recruits lifting the standards, as the Club looks to continue its rise up the Pascoe ladder.



2022 shapes as an exciting year for the Warriors in the Pascoe as Hellers hard graft creating a Club culture bears fruit, an atmosphere which has attracted players as well as sponsors, such as Proline Painting, which has afforded a massive improvement in infrastructure, facilities and equipment. The Men have improved year on year since Heller to the helm in 2020, a year which was an enormous rebuilding project for the Club’s Pascoe set up, Heller effectively having only four first grade players, yet the cultural foundations were carefully being laid.

That year the Club joined forces with the Estella Phoenix to enter a side in the FWW Under 16s competition. In 2020 the South Wagga Phoenix U16’s rarely gave up the top spot, they were unlucky to lose the Grand Final in a competition they dominated. In 2020 those Under 16s were rewarded with minutes in First Grade. The majority of players have become handy Pascoe players, having the headstart over their peers with many first grade minutes under their belt before they can even gain entry to the Clubs major sponsor the Victoria Hotel.

The seeds began to sprout in 2021 as Souths increasing professionalism & desire was rewarded. In a covid enfornced shortened season Warriors finished equal seventh with inner-city rivals Wagga United on ten points, the Club recorded 3 wins over Cootamundra and Tolland and a spicy 3 all draw in the Derby against United. On top of this the under 16’s became the bulk of the 2nd grade, whose enterprising play having them challenging for the title. Southies had two sides in the 3rd grade men’s, led by Faisal’s Gladiators which utterly dominated the competiton.
